Liverpool are set to rival Chelsea and Arsenal for Ajax's £35m-rated forward David Neres.
The 22-year-old has scored against both Real Madrid and Juventus during Ajax’s Champions League run to become one of the most sought after players.
According to The Sun, Liverpool have now joined their domestic rivals in the pursuit of the winger.
Chelsea's interest will ultimately depend on their appeal against a transfer ban imposed by FIFA.
Meanwhile, Arsenal have also declared an interest in Neres who moved to the Dutch capital from Sao Paulo three years ago.
Neres earned his first senior cap for Brazil earlier this year and has scored 29 goals in 95 appearances for Ajax.
